• No Gear Upgrades – Because you will be completing only quests, you will likely find that your characters get all the gear they need as you go forward. Until you reach Level 80, there is no reason to buy any gear.
• Get Your Mounts – Players can now get a land mount at Level 20 and then 40. Make sure that you have the 6 gold needed to get your Level 20 mount and then when you hit Level 40. This can dramatically boost your leveling speed by making it easier to get around.
• Always Log Out in a Town – Whenever you log out at the end of the day, I recommend you hearth back to your nearest town and log out in the inn. Not only will this make it so you can get whatever supplies you need when you log-in the next day, while also not having to spend much time worrying about running back, but you will gain rested XP for a small period of time when you login next. Sometimes, it only lasts a few minutes, but it is a 200% boost on your XP gain that will add up over the course of the game.
Questing
In addition to having your character streamlined to minimize mindless errands, you should never complete anything but quests. Any good WoW leveling guide will tell you this over and over again and they are right. For most of the game, finding these quests and completing them is relatively easy though.
For instance, most quests are centralized. You will go to a town or a camp and find between 2 and 6 NPCs who hand out quests. Grab all of those quests and then complete them all at once. When done, turn the quests in together and get the next set to move on to higher levels. Not only do you get tremendous amounts of bonus XP from completing quests, you get the XP you gain from killing mobs in those quests.
Add-ons To Install
The last thing I can recommend to severely reduce time spent in the game on quests is a handful of add-ons and mods that make your gameplay a bit easier. These add-ons are completely legal to use and are easy to install. They also run smoothly in the game and have been tested extensively.
• Cartographer/Tom-Tom – There are a few map-mod add-ons that will add enhanced navigation to your mini-map and main map. Things like coordinates on the main screen and major quest hubs can be marked this way. They also unlock entire maps before you explore them so you don’t get lost.
• Quest Helper – This mod will add an additional bit of information for each quest you get, telling you where to go and what needs to be done (since some quests are confusing). With your map mod, this will make it easy to find just about anything.
• TitanPanel – This mod will add a simple pane across the top of your window that shows you vital information about your character and current status including bag slots, XP needed to level up, gold count and more.
These three mods will all help you make your game a bit faster and easier to navigate, ultimately speeding up your leveling time exponentially.
